Smiling Shark SD1023 LED Torch Light XPE Super Bright Flashlight with Hook Camping Light Rechargeable Zoomable Waterproof

Smiling Shark SD1023 LED Torch Light XPE Super Bright Flashlight with Hook Camping Light Rechargeable Zoomable Waterproof

Aliexpress UK